St Thomas, the jewel of the Caribbean, welcomes travelers with its stunning landscapes and vibrant culture. Exploring this paradise becomes
Continue reading
St Thomas, the jewel of the Caribbean, welcomes travelers with its stunning landscapes and vibrant culture. Exploring this paradise becomes
Continue reading